Boston Avenue Charter School was opened in the 2008-2009 school year. We started the school year with one teacher per grade level and focused on individualizing instruction to meet the needs of each child in our school. As with all good schools, we worked with parents and students to create a dynamic atmosphere where each student felt respected and looked forward to attending school each morning. There are many parents that could tell you their personal experiences with our school. The day to day transformation that many of our students made was remarkable. We strive to provide a learning environment like no other, where each child is recognized for their accomplishments and encouraged to keep working hard to tackle difficult subject areas. Not only do our students receive the encouragement they need to succeed, they also receive the support and guidance from their teacher and peers. Boston Avenue Charter School focus on having a small family environment, offering small class sizes and a personal approach to education. We incorporate technology in our lessons as well as hands on projects. Students participate in a variety of special areas such as physical education, art, music, and horticulture to name a few. Students that attend our school learn a lot about respecting themselves and others, regardless of differences and abilities. We truly are a small town school, where teachers know most of the students. In addition to being a small school, we practice being a healthy green school. Students learn how to recycle and use environmentally friendly resources to clean and disinfect their surroundings.
